Why Forensic Science?

More Than a Science—A Foundation for Life.

At Gemini Forensic Academy, we use the high-stakes world of forensic investigation to teach students how to navigate the complexities of the modern world. Our PhD-led curriculum is designed not just to create future investigators, but to build sharper, more ethical, and more resilient young adults.

🕵️‍♂️ Critical Thinking & Logic: The Power of Deductive Reasoning

In an era of misinformation and “deepfakes,” the ability to distinguish fact from fiction is a vital survival skill. Forensic science teaches students to:

  • Move Beyond Assumptions: Students learn to look at a “crime scene”—or any complex problem—without bias, gathering data before forming a theory.

  • Master Deductive Reasoning: By connecting seemingly unrelated clues to reach a logical conclusion, students develop the cognitive “muscles” needed for high-level problem-solving in any career field.

  • Analyze Evidence-Based Outcomes: We teach students how to defend their findings with data, a skill that translates directly to academic writing and professional presentations.

🧪 Real-World STEM Integration: Science with a Purpose

Forensics is the ultimate “applied science.” We take abstract concepts from the classroom and put them into the hands of students through practical, field-based applications:

  • Biology: Exploring DNA analysis, physiology, and the science of the human body to understand identity and cause.

  • Chemistry: Utilizing toxicology and chemical reactions to identify unknown substances and analyze trace evidence.

  • Mathematics: Applying geometry and physics to reconstruct events, from analyzing blood spatter patterns to calculating ballistics and trajectory.

    This hands-on approach turns STEM from a “requirement” into an engaging, career-ready toolkit.

⚖️ Ethics & Character: The Unbreakable Foundation

A great investigator requires more than just technical skill; they require an “Unbreakable Foundation” of integrity. Our program emphasizes the psychological and ethical responsibilities of working within the justice system:

  • The Pursuit of Truth: We instill a deep respect for the facts, teaching students that their primary duty is to the truth, regardless of the outcome.

  • Justice & Integrity: By exploring the school-to-prison pipeline and forensic psychology, students gain a sophisticated understanding of how bias impacts justice and why ethical oversight is mandatory.

  • Character Development: We focus on the “forensic mindset”—patience, precision, and the courage to stand by one’s evidence even under pressure.
